Summary
This is a Mechatronic construction project based on automation and robotic designs. This shall enable students practical ability to design, construct, choose the right mechanical and electronic systems for robotic functionalities.
Target Students
Second year Mechatronic engineering students on courses offered by Department of Electrical and Electronic Engineering

Educational Aims
To develop key design and development skills needed by modern engineers, and to provide a guided application of the concepts and theory taught in the second year of all undergraduate courses in the Department of Electrical and Electronic Engineering.Learning Outcomes
1. Demonstrate an ability to design solutions to real world practical problems through the application of basic mechactronic engineering concepts.
2. Develop robust computer codes, designed to meet a specific task and show how concepts in programming relate to the devices on which code is executed.
3. Acquire and analyse experimental data, including the evaluation of system performance.
4. Select and use appropriate laboratory equipment and apply computer software based tools for: the design, simulation, construction and analysis of mechatronic systems.
